Residents of Kalofer dance traditional men-only horo chain dance in the Tundzha River

Residents of Kalofer dressed in folk costumes stepped into the icy waters of the Tundzha River on Friday morning to observe the Epiphany tradition and dance the men-only horo chain dance. They were led by the town mayor Rumen Stoyanov who was holding a national flag. Earlier, the brave men were blessed by Father Demetrius from the local St. Archangel Michael Church. The ritual rescuing of the Holy Cross was also observed. Unlike other years, the weather in Kalofer today is mild and temperatures are much more favourable.

The Orthodox Church celebrates with solemn services one of its greatest feasts – The Feast of Epiphany. Epiphany commemorates the Baptism of Christ in the Jordan River, at which the Trinitarian nature of God is manifested.
